Description

OFFERED WITHOUT RESERVE

General Motors introduced the front-wheel drive W-body in 1987, controversially replacing the rear-wheel drive G-platform. However, it proved a wise move, as the W-body would remain in production for a remarkable 19 years, selling in the millions across the Chevrolet, Buick, Oldsmobile, and Pontiac marques. Of the various models available on the W-body platform, only one received a convertible body style: the Oldsmobile Cutlass Supreme. The convertible variant utilized an unusual top mechanism with fixed B-pillars supporting a prominent roll hoop, but was otherwise similar to the two-door coupe and powered by the same 3.1-liter V6. This White over dark red 1992 Oldsmobile Cutlass Supreme Convertible was purchased new by George Foreman and displays a mere 9,912 miles at the time of listing. With its distinctive “mini-quad” headlights and fixed roll bar, this quirky 90s convertible is sure to draw a crowd at its next RADwood event. 

This car is part of the George Foreman Collection, which comprises over 50 cars from the 1930s through today, with a focus on American classics and late-model sports cars.

Known Imperfections

  • Please note that the vehicles in The George Foreman Collection have been in long-term static storage and will benefit from additional mechanical attention prior to being driven. Bidders are encouraged to review the Additional Documents section of each lot for any recent mechanical service rendered to help return certain vehicles to running condition. Additionally, bidders should carefully review the photos of each lot in the collection, which may highlight the oxidation of metal components certain vehicles sustained as the result of a garage fire caused by a golf cart battery in March 2019. Although none of the vehicles sustained fire damage from the fire itself, the negative cosmetic effects of the corrosive soot vary greatly from vehicle to vehicle and can be observed in the photo galleries of each lot. All lots are sold as is, where is, and bidders are responsible for any desired diligence before placing a bid.

Ownership History

This 1992 Oldsmobile Cutlass Supreme Convertible was purchased new by George Foreman and first registered in Texas in March 1992 showing 25 miles at the time. The accompanying CARFAX Vehicle Report verifies its one-owner status and low original mileage of 9,912 miles.
